[Bug 1094722] Re: Raring: regression: fan keeps spinning at full speed after suspend

2013-05-05 Thread Jukka Alasalmi
I have a HP ProBook 4710s. I'm suffering the same issue, but I have to echo 0 to cooling_devices from 0 to 10 to have the fan at the usual speed (there are devices from 0 to 15 on this laptop). It seems that the fan speed depends on the smallest device having the state as 1. This seems however to s

[Bug 1174332] Re: Digital audio output not working

2013-05-01 Thread Jukka Marin
After some digging I noticed that the S/PDIF output was simply muted by ALSA. I unmuted it in alsamixer and now it works. I _did_ try to do this before submitting a bug report, but for some reason, I couldn't get it to work. Sorry for the false alarm. ** Changed in: linux (Ubuntu) Statu

[Bug 809888] [NEW] Calc:Some functions treat '5 as a number, some don't

2011-07-13 Thread Jukka Lind
Public bug reported: In Calc: Situation: cell A1 has a number typed in as text w apostrophe beginning such as '123 This cell gives diffenrent results in functions. SUM(A1) gives zero answer, but =A1 gives a value of 123. This can be misleading, especially when the apostrophe is not shown o
